i am running xp pro fully updated.could someone recommend a good safe site to
download free fonts. my wife designs greetings cards as a hobby and some more
font designs would come in handy. or maybe there is a way to design our own
fonts. Any help would be greatly appreciated.
thank you

AFAIK fonts aren't executable, so provided you don't run an exe, bat, com
file etc, you downloaded as a font I can't see a problem. Most font file
I've seen are just stored in zip/rar archives.

It should be noted that having too many font's on your system can slow it
down. At least this was true under earlier versions of Windows. Maybe
someone could confirm/deny that under XP.

I can't recommend a good site though, but I've never had a problem with
downloaded fonts - except you will find the same ones often on different
sites.
